Montana Rangeland Carbon Sequestration Project Pool

This project consists of 9 ranching contracts that have been pooled together, representing 28,570 hectares (70,600 acres) of rangeland in southeastern Montana (Carter, Custer, and Powder River counties).  Ranchers in this project are committed to carefully managed rotational grazing practices for cattle and horses that allow the grassland communities to sequester CO2 in the soil.  Different sections of the rangeland are rested during different times of year, and this pattern is switched from year to year to allow grassland plant species a chance to re-seed and persist over time.  The grazing plans of these ranches also maintain habitat for wildlife species such as mule deer, whitetail deer, pheasant, antelope, elk, sharp tail grouse, and sage grouse.  The Montana Rangeland project has generated Carbon Sequestration Offsets on the Chicago Climate Exchange (CCX) for the years 2003-2007.  This project was verified by a CCX-approved auditor and entered the CCX through an aggregator of rangeland emissions reduction projects.
